Sound effects box with
- speaker and amplifier,
- sound card with 6 minutes of digital sound effects,
- and 5 inputs for sensors
- control chip

When triggered, a variety of sound effects follow.

Types of sensors

- Touch / Step / Hit sensor
- Vibration sensor
- Beam brake sensor
- Passive Infra Red sensor
- Proximity sensor

Example - Sounds inside a slide

Set of beam breake sensors build into slide trigger different “speeeeed” sounds.

HOUNDCRAFT - Interactive Treasure Hunt

Interactive treasure hunt. Kids take a wrist band with a sensor on it around your SoftPlay arena. The idea is that the kids find certain objects within your soft play arena i.e. The blue slide, the tree, the space tunnel etc.. The kids touch their wrist sensor on it at which point it tells them if either they have found the right item or if it's incorrect. For each item they find correctly, the item will then direct them to find the next item. There is not a limit to how many objects have a sensor on them per arena.
